9 Body Language Signs A Girl Is Interested In You

Attraction doesn’t always show up in words. In fact, most of the time, it shows up in how she moves, how she looks at you, and how she reacts around you. 

The problem is—most guys miss it. They overthink, expect something obvious, or misread signals that actually mean the opposite.

Body language doesn’t lie, but it can be subtle. Knowing what to look for gives you a better read on the situation, so you’re not stuck guessing or making weird moves at the wrong time. 

Here’s how to tell if she’s feeling you… without her having to say a thing.

1. She Finds Reasons to Be Close to You

A girl who’s into you will close the distance. She’ll find ways to sit near you, stand beside you, or “accidentally” bump into you more than once. 

That closeness isn’t random—it’s her comfort showing. She wants to be in your space without making it too obvious.

Sometimes it’s small: leaning in while talking, brushing against your arm, or standing a little too close in a quiet moment. 

If it happens once, sure, maybe it’s nothing. But if it keeps happening? She’s doing it on purpose, even if she won’t admit it.

That said, context matters. Crowded room? Everyone’s close. But if there’s plenty of space and she’s still right next to you—take the hint. 

A girl won’t keep getting physically closer to a guy she doesn’t want around.

2. Her Eyes Keep Coming Back to You

Eye contact says a lot—but how she looks away tells you even more. 

If she locks eyes, then looks down with a smile or glances back quickly after looking away, she’s not just being polite. That flicker of hesitation is nerves, and nerves usually mean interest.

Pay attention to the patterns. If you catch her staring more than once or notice she looks at you the moment something funny or interesting happens, that’s not random. 

She’s checking your reaction. She wants to feel connected to you in the moment.

Some girls are bold and hold the stare. Others are more shy and look away fast. 

But the fact she’s looking in the first place—again and again—means you’ve got her attention. People don’t stare at things they’re not drawn to.

3. She Mirrors Your Movements or Expressions

This one flies under the radar, but it’s one of the clearest signals. 

If you notice she starts copying how you sit, how you gesture, or even how you laugh—it’s her brain syncing with yours. People mirror the energy they like being around.

You lean forward, and suddenly she does too. You scratch your head, and a moment later she adjusts her hair. 

Not exact copies, but little things like that show she’s paying close attention to you—without even realizing it. That kind of subtle imitation is rooted in connection.

Now don’t start testing it on purpose or making it weird. Just stay aware of the flow. If you’re relaxed and she naturally matches that vibe, you’re not imagining it. 

That’s a clear green light. She feels in tune with you—and her body language proves it.

4. She Plays With Her Hair or Accessories Around You

Fidgeting can be a strong giveaway—but it’s not just random nervous energy. 

When a girl likes a guy, she often starts touching her hair, adjusting her clothes, or playing with whatever’s in her hands. It’s her body’s way of releasing that tension and pulling your attention.

Now, not all hair-touching means attraction. It matters how she does it. Quick, frustrated movements? 

Probably just stress. But soft twirling, slow brushing, or tucking it behind her ear while looking at you? 

That’s a whole different thing. That’s her being hyper-aware of how she looks in your presence.

She’s not trying to impress the room. She’s focused on you. These little actions are often unconscious, which makes them more genuine. 

If you see it happening more than once during the convo—and it’s paired with a smile or long eye contact—there’s interest there.

5. She Reacts Strongly to Your Presence

Her whole vibe shifts when you show up. Maybe her posture straightens, her tone gets lighter, or she suddenly starts laughing more. 

You walk into the room, and without saying anything, she lights up. That’s not coincidence. That’s interest.

Pay attention to how she acts around others compared to how she acts around you. 

If you notice she becomes more expressive, more playful, or more alert when you’re near, she’s aware of your presence in a big way. That’s her energy shifting to match the person she’s focused on.

It’s not always loud or obvious. Sometimes it’s the way she suddenly fixes her hair, adjusts her outfit, or looks toward you right after arriving. 

These quick, instinctive changes reveal a lot. A girl who doesn’t care doesn’t shift like that.

6. She Keeps the Conversation Going, Even Without a Topic

When a girl likes you, silence feels awkward to her, not just you. 

So she fills it—with random stories, questions, little jokes, or even stuff that seems kind of pointless. It’s not about the topic, it’s about staying connected.

You might notice her talking about something totally out of the blue, or bringing up small details you mentioned before. 

That’s not her being bored. That’s her trying to keep your attention without making it too obvious. She wants to keep the energy flowing.

Most people don’t put in effort to stretch a conversation unless they’re invested. 

A girl who keeps showing curiosity, who keeps giving you reasons to stay in the moment with her—she’s trying to build a vibe. Don’t ignore that. It’s a subtle, but real sign she’s into you.

7. She Finds Excuses to Touch You

Touch is one of the clearest signs of attraction—especially when she initiates it. 

A quick touch on your arm, a playful shove, a high five that lingers a bit too long… these aren’t just random moves. They’re small, low-key ways of testing physical closeness.

It’s rarely over-the-top. She’s not grabbing you or being too obvious. It might be her brushing lint off your shirt or tapping your leg while laughing. 

These tiny touches are her way of breaking the physical barrier without making it feel awkward.

Of course, some people are just naturally touchy. So you have to read it in context. 

If she doesn’t do that with other guys but keeps doing it around you, that’s not by chance. She’s comfortable with you—and wants you to feel that comfort too.

8. Her Feet and Body Point Toward You

Body orientation tells you more than facial expressions sometimes. 

Even if she’s pretending not to pay much attention, check her posture. If her body—especially her feet—is pointed in your direction, she’s engaged, whether she admits it or not.

A girl who’s into you naturally faces toward you. That includes her shoulders, knees, and even how she angles her hips while standing. 

It’s a physical sign of focus, even when she’s not directly talking to you. Her body is staying open to you.

On the flip side, if her feet are constantly turned away or she angles herself to the side, she might be mentally checked out. 

But if she keeps realigning herself in your direction, even in group settings, that’s her attention choosing you—without saying a word.

9. She Laughs Easily Around You

You don’t have to be a stand-up comedian. You just have to be you. 

A girl who likes you will laugh at things that aren’t even that funny. Not because she’s fake, but because she enjoys the way you make her feel.

Laughter creates closeness. It lowers tension and makes everything more relaxed. 

If she’s constantly giggling at your jokes, reacting with playfulness, or leaning in while she laughs, she’s clearly enjoying your presence. 

That kind of reaction isn’t forced—it’s emotional chemistry showing up in real time.

Now, not every laugh means interest. But if she’s fully engaged, eyes locked on you, smiling wide, and laughing more with you than anyone else around? That’s different. She’s not just being polite—she’s into you.
